A riveting novel of two women, two millennia apart, set in the exotic cultures of ancient and present-day Egypt. Justine Jenner has come to Cairo to forge her own path from the legacies of her parents, an Egyptian beauty and an American archaeologist. After an earthquake nearly buries her alive in an underground crypt, she discovers an ancient codex, written by a woman whose secrets threaten the foundations of both Christian and Muslim beliefs. As political instability rocks the region, Justine is thrust into a world where even those she trusts may betray her in order to control the codex's revelations.
